Looks like it might've been recorded abroad (i.e. not here in L.A.). The engineer (Dick Lewsey) appears to work in the U.K. Listening to a couple sample clips on Amazon, maybe it was Fletch? Kinda sounds like him a bit, but without a good listen to the CD, that'd just be an educated guess.CAVEMAN
Lalo Schifrin
Mexico City, Mexico and London, England: 1981
Lalo Schifrin with orchestra.
a. Caveman (Main Title) (Lalo Schifrin) - 10:31
b. The Kissing Plant (Lalo Schifrin) - 6:25
c. The Horn Lizard (Lalo Schifrin) - 5:21
d. Tyrannosaurus Rex (Lalo Schifrin) - 4:25
e. Homo Erectus (Lalo Schifrin) - 6:26
f. Pterodactyl (Lalo Schifrin) - 7:11
g. William Tell Overture - 3:25
h. March Of The Caveman (Lalo Schifrin) - 2:01
i. Prehistoric Dance (Lalo Schifrin) - 5:15
j. Caveman (End Title) (Lalo Schifrin) - 3:02
Issues: a-j on Aleph 032 [CD] (issued June 7, 2005).
Producer: Nick Redman. Executive Producer: Donna Schifrin
Engineer: Dick Lewsey
Notes: Jon Burlingame
